the rubber undercoat in a spray can costs like 7 bucks a piece and i used prolly 5-7 cans too do one light coat and too thicker coats. the only way to mess up on this is a you suck at taping and you get it every where or you dont let the coats dry properly, i waited a day between coats. defienetly worth it

I smoked the stock taillights and third breaklight. I do alot of backin in the driveway at night, so i taped off the reverse lights so they still shine bright. They look kinda cool too. When i bought this truck it had the same trim on it, i removed it the day i brought it home.
